Step Subtractions & Inverse Check
1. \( 762 \div 3 \) Quotient = 254
• \( 7 \div 3 = 2 \) (R1) → \( 7 - 6 = 1 \), bring down 6 → 16
• \( 16 \div 3 = 5 \) (R1) → \( 16 - 15 = 1 \), bring down 2 → 12
• \( 12 \div 3 = 4 \) (R0) → \( 12 - 12 = 0 \)
• Check: \( 254 \times 3 = 762 \) ✓
2. \( 936 \div 4 \) Quotient = 234
• \( 9 \div 4 = 2 \) (R1) → \( 9 - 8 = 1 \), bring down 3 → 13
• \( 13 \div 4 = 3 \) (R1) → \( 13 - 12 = 1 \), bring down 6 → 16
• \( 16 \div 4 = 4 \) (R0) → \( 16 - 16 = 0 \)
• Check: \( 234 \times 4 = 936 \) ✓
3. \( 852 \div 6 \) Quotient = 142
• \( 8 \div 6 = 1 \) (R2) → \( 8 - 6 = 2 \), bring down 5 → 25
• \( 25 \div 6 = 4 \) (R1) → \( 25 - 24 = 1 \), bring down 2 → 12
• \( 12 \div 6 = 2 \) (R0) → \( 12 - 12 = 0 \)
• Check: \( 142 \times 6 = 852 \) ✓
4. \( 945 \div 7 \) Quotient = 135
• \( 9 \div 7 = 1 \) (R2) → \( 9 - 7 = 2 \), bring down 4 → 24
• \( 24 \div 7 = 3 \) (R3) → \( 24 - 21 = 3 \), bring down 5 → 35
• \( 35 \div 7 = 5 \) (R0) → \( 35 - 35 = 0 \)
• Check: \( 135 \times 7 = 945 \) ✓
5. \( 696 \div 8 \) Quotient = 87
• \( 6 < 8 \): consider 69
• \( 69 \div 8 = 8 \) (R5) → \( 69 - 64 = 5 \), bring down 6 → 56
• \( 56 \div 8 = 7 \) (R0) → \( 56 - 56 = 0 \)
• Check: \( 87 \times 8 = 696 \) ✓
6. \( 828 \div 9 \) Quotient = 92
• \( 8 < 9 \): consider 82
• \( 82 \div 9 = 9 \) (R1) → \( 82 - 81 = 1 \), bring down 8 → 18
• \( 18 \div 9 = 2 \) (R0) → \( 18 - 18 = 0 \)
• Check: \( 92 \times 9 = 828 \) ✓
